Cables: The Unseen Offenders

If there’s one thing that ruins a sleek mounted TV, it’s visible wiring. Tangled cords not only spoil the visual symmetry but can also pose hazards—especially in homes with pets or children.

Professionally handled TV installation Ottawa usually includes thoughtful cable management. That could mean routing cords through the wall, hiding them in discreet raceways, or organizing multiple connected devices in a way that keeps them accessible but out of sight.

And while cable concealment might seem like a small touch, it’s one that can dramatically improve the room's overall atmosphere. It makes the tech feel part of the home, not an afterthought.

Home Entertainment as a Design Element

Interior design magazines now treat televisions like wall art. Not because the screens themselves have changed—though many are thin enough to resemble a painting—but because the way they’re mounted creates visual flow.

Mounting a TV isn’t just for media rooms anymore. Bedrooms, kitchens, home gyms, and even bathrooms are seeing screens installed. But each of these spaces requires a different eye.

A kitchen TV might need to swivel so it can be viewed while cooking. A bedroom setup needs to consider both seated and lying down angles. A screen in a home gym should be positioned for motion, not stillness.

All of this requires forethought—something that a standard bracket-and-screws approach can’t deliver.

Seasonal Considerations and Outdoor Installs

Ottawa experiences all four seasons with intensity. If you’re thinking beyond the living room and planning a TV setup on a covered deck or three-season room, the stakes are higher. Outdoor TV installation Ottawa must account for humidity, wind, glare, and rapid temperature changes.

That means weather-rated mounts, sealed cable paths, and surfaces that won’t warp or degrade in extreme conditions. Outdoor installations require a very different skill set and an understanding of both tech and climate. It's not a weekend DIY project—it’s a technical challenge with a big payoff when done right.
